Requirements
5+ years in data quality engineering, data engineering, or backend engineering with a strong focus on automated testing and data validation
Strong proficiency in Python and SQL, including experience with relational and cloud-hosted databases
Experience building test automation and validation frameworks for data pipelines, APIs, and microservices using pytest or similar tools
Experience with data pipeline orchestration tools (e.g., Airflow, Databricks) and cloud data infrastructure
Experience with data quality frameworks such as Great Expectations is a strong plus
Comfortable working across engineering, data science, and product to communicate data quality standards and tradeoffs to both technical and non-technical stakeholders

Responsibilities
Build and maintain data validation frameworks for critical measurement and reporting pipelines
Develop automated data quality checks across ingestion, transformation, and reporting layers
Own pytest infrastructure improvements and drive integration testing patterns across the engineering org
Partner with engineers, data scientists, and product managers to debug complex data issues and define data quality standards
Evaluate, adopt, and own data quality and lineage tooling to improve pipeline observability and traceability
Define and enforce data quality standards for new feature launches and pipeline changes
